Crafting Compelling Call Scripts
Your script is your guide, not your cage. Develop openings that grab attention immediately. State your purpose clearly and concisely. Focus on benefits, not just features. Ask open-ended questions to encourage dialogue. Listen actively to responses. Adapt your approach based on the conversation flow. Practice makes perfect. Refine your script based on call outcomes.
The Importance of Active Listening
Active listening is a cornerstone of unique telemarketing. It means truly hearing what your prospect is saying. Pay attention to their tone and wording. Respond thoughtfully to their concerns. Paraphrasing what you hear confirms understanding. It shows respect for their input. This builds stronger connections. It also reveals crucial insights.

Mastering Follow-Up Techniques
The follow-up is often where sales are made. Plan your follow-up strategy in advance. Determine the best timing and method. Reference previous conversations. Reinforce the value you offer. Avoid being pushy or intrusive. The goal is to stay top-of-mind positively. Persistence with politeness is key.
Adapting to Different Communication Styles
Not everyone communicates the same way. Recognize and adapt to different communication styles. Some prospects prefer directness. Others appreciate a more consultative approach. Observe their language and adjust your own. Flexibility ensures a better customer experience. It also increases the likelihood of a positive outcome.
Utilizing Technology for Efficiency
Technology can greatly enhance your telemarketing efforts. CRM systems help manage contacts and track interactions. Call recording allows for performance analysis. Automated dialers can improve efficiency. However, always balance technology with the human touch. Ensure your technology supports, not replaces, personal connection.
